Why Intelligent Automation in Banking Fails: It's Not a Technology Problem

Image
The banking industry has invested billions in automation technologies over the past decade, yet many institutions struggle to realize the transformative benefits promised by vendors and consultants. Walk through most banks today, and you'll still find employees manually processing loan applications, reconciling accounts by hand, and drowning in compliance paperwork despite sophisticated automation platforms sitting underutilized in their technology stacks. The uncomfortable truth that few industry leaders acknowledge: technology is rarely the reason automation initiatives fail. After observing dozens of Intelligent Automation in Banking implementations across institutions ranging from community banks to multinational corporations, a clear pattern emerges. The projects that succeed treat automation as an organizational transformation challenge that happens to involve technology. The projects that fail treat it as a technology implementation challenge that happens to involve people....
